This week in our class we investigated pumpkins.
We learned about the life-cycle of a pumpkin, learned about it's parts, and explored real pumpkins.

We first did sink/float experiments.
And wrote in our journals.
And compared lengths.
Then we weighed our pumpkins.
We measured the circumference of each pumpkin.
Each table counted how many seeds were in their pumpkin.
They put 10 seeds in each circle,so we only had to count by 10s! Genius!
We made a flow chart to explain the life cycle of a pumpkin.
And turned it into writing.
Then the kids labeled the parts of a pumpkin and wrote their own descriptions of the life cycle.
